The worldwide group rejected a ruling that validated Maduro’s victory

August 24, 2024 Catherine Williams - Chief Editor News

|| AFP company

**Eleven American international locations, EU diplomacy, the OAS and Spain supported the necessity to submit the information and perform a verification**

“It fully lacks credibility”, “we have now not seen any proof”, “it tries to validate outcomes with out assist”: america, the pinnacle of diplomacy of the European Union and 10 Latin American international locations on Friday rejected the judgment and validated the re-election of President Nicolás Maduro in Venezuela.

Washington thought it was “time” for the ruling Chavismo and the opposition to “start conversations about political transition.”

The independence of the CNE and the TSJ has been questioned by the opposition and the UN mission.

The CNE has not printed outcomes desk by desk, as required by legislation, claiming that its system was hacked.

The opposition led by former deputy María Corina Machado, for its half, printed copies of scrutiny information on an internet site which, it maintains, show the victory of its candidate with 67% of the votes.

It’s a part of the “overwhelming proof” the US says exists of Maduro’s defeat. And the supreme court docket’s ruling “completely lacks credibility,” stated Vedant Patel, a spokesman for the State Division, who is looking for talks to be held for a “respectful and peaceable” transition.

Washington additionally signed the refusal of 10 Latin American international locations (Argentina, Costa Rica, Chile, Ecuador, Guatemala, Panama, Paraguay, Peru, the Dominican Republic and Uruguay) to a ruling that they declare they “intend to confirm the unaided outcomes printed by the “electoral” physique.

“Solely an neutral and unbiased examination of the votes, which evaluates all of the information, will guarantee respect for the favored will,” the doc acknowledged.

The overall secretariat of the Group of American States has additionally rejected the ruling.

“We have now not seen any proof,” stated the Excessive Consultant of the European Union for Overseas Affairs, Josep Borrell.

“Till we see a verifiable outcome, we aren’t going to acknowledge it,” Borrell declared in Santander, Spain, the place he stated he was making an attempt to get the 27 EU international locations “to ascertain a place” as a bloc.

For now, the Spanish authorities requested to “publish the information in a whole and verifiable method.”

When requested if he acknowledges Maduro’s re-election, Mexico’s president, leftist Andrés Manuel López Obrador, stated this Friday that he’ll wait “for the information to be launched.”

López Obrador was a part of a joint initiative together with his Brazilian counterparts,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va, and Colombian, Gustavo Petro, to advertise dialogue. Lula and Petro – who’ve but to touch upon the Venezuelan Supreme Courtroom ruling – proposed a brand new election, an concept flatly rejected by Maduro and the opposition.

Cuba and Nicaragua for his or her half celebrated the ruling.

RESPONSES FROM VENEZUELA

Overseas Minister Yván Gil described this “impolite and reckless” textual content as “an unacceptable act of interference.”

Machado welcomed the assertion. “At this level, nobody buys the crude motion of the TSJ,” he wrote on the X community, whereas González Urrutia issued a press release – which he indicators as “the president of all” – with a brand new encouragement to the group worldwide .

“I ask the nations of the world to stay agency in defending our democracy and to proceed to ask the organs of the State for transparency of their actions.”
